Dental implants without the mystery

Implants change lives when done well. They likewise create migraines if prepared freely. The phrase "oral implants periodontist" shows up on several Google searches because individuals wish to know who is steering the ship. At Oral Styles Boston, implant treatment is collective and transparent. If a periodontist or oral specialist is the best expert to put the implant, the recommendation includes a led strategy and a common goal: emergence account, soft tissue density, and restorative area mapped ahead of time.

I have actually sat through their implant consults. They talk numbers and timelines truthfully. A lot of single-tooth instances require 3 to six months from removal to last crown, depending on bone quality and whether grafting is essential. Immediate implants are possible in choose situations with undamaged outlets and great primary security, yet they are not offered as magic methods. People hear why cigarette smoking, inadequately managed diabetic issues, and nighttime clenching alter success rates, and what can be done to minimize those risks.

Cost, openness, and the lengthy horizon

Dentistry is healthcare with a price you really feel. Crowns in Boston run from roughly 1,400 to 2,200 dollars depending on product and complexity. Implants, including positioning and restoration, frequently range from 4,000 to 6,500 per tooth when grafting is involved. Orthodontics, aligners versus braces, brings a different variety. Dental Designs Boston does something basic that even more clinics must do: they place arrays in writing, clarify what drives the number up or down, and show you where insurance aids and where it does not. No one loves speaking deductibles and yearly optimums, yet it beats the shock of a surprise bill.

They likewise design in phases. You do not have to do everything at the same time. Support illness initially, tackle the most susceptible teeth next, after that move to visual appeals. What an emergency situation plan appears like before you require it

If you live, function, or study downtown, your "dental expert near me" requires to be more than an advertising and marketing line when a tooth breaks at 7 a.m. before a discussion. A straightforward plan makes a distinction:

    Save the practice number in your phone and know their emergency situation hours. If a tooth cracks, maintain the piece moist in milk or saline and call immediately. For a knocked-out tooth, manage it by the crown, not the root, and try to return carefully if clean. If not feasible, maintain it wet and obtain seen within 60 minutes. Use a cool compress for swelling, and stay clear of heat on presumed infections. Do not self-start anti-biotics without assistance; they can mask signs and symptoms and complicate diagnosis.

These actions get time and maintain alternatives. The clinic's desire to see you rapidly turns a situation into a solvable problem.
